By the way, some tips if you’re going to shop with them:
- If you know what you want before you go, buy it online first and choose the “Pick up in store” option…you’ll automatically get 5% off.
- Sign up for their rewards program (especially if you buy furniture from them). Â We’ve gotten many $10 gift cards over the years. Â Plus you get additional discounts through the year.
- Google “World Market” coupon before checking out. Â There is almost always a working 10% off code that they let you have.
- Wait for sales. Â Their sales are big (like 20-50% off), and they rotate through entire departments at once.
